Michael Howell
62 years old

Texas City, Texas, 77590

Possible Match for Michael Howell in Rural Retreat, VA

Our top match for Michael Howell lives on 15th Ave N in Texas City, Texas and may have previously resided on International Blvd in Texas City, Texas. Michael is 62 years of age and may be related to Gayland Howell, Gene Sims and Thresia Howell. Run a full report on this result to get more details on Michael.